Текущее время: 22 ноя 2024, 05:43


Правила форума

Счетчик сообщений в этом форуме выключен.



 Страница 1 из 1 [ Сообщений: 7 ] 
Автор
Сообщение
[ТС]
 Заголовок сообщения: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 08 мар 2021, 17:29 
Я тут случайно
Я тут случайно
Аватара пользователя
Зарегистрирован: 18 янв 2016, 11:46
Наличности на руках:
4.01

Сообщения: 2
Откуда: Antonik
Здравствуйте! Принесли данный программатор у него проблема на микроконтроллере STM32F103RET6 замыкание линии
PB7. Заказал новую такую же микросхему на Али и решил прочитать прошивку через Usb Uart программатором. Опыта с чтением прошивок никогда не имел хоть несколько раз записывал прошивку на подобные.
И вот когда в первые увидел надпись "WARNING Remove Protection ...." где предупреждения об зашиты и если его убрать то прошивка будет стерта - это я потом узнал а сперва я по гуглил и попал сюда https://istarik.ru/blog/stm32/111.html. Где сказана "... означает, что плата, залочена. Ничего страшного нет, просто снимите защиту кнопкой Remove protection и следом нажмите ОК."
В общем стер с неё прошивку и теперь обыскал весь гугл чтоб найти на неё прошивку под микроконтроллер STM32F103RET6.
Есть кто может выложить прошивку под загрузку через usb uart? Ну или хоть дайте совет у кого можно её достать.

ЗЫ В папке с программой есть прошивака iCopy.bin также находил в инете iCopy_bat_2_2_6.bin, iCopy_plus2.3.7.bin и тому подобные. Пробовал залить их все без толку они не под uart.


Не в сети
 Профиль    
 
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 09 мар 2021, 09:35 
Начинающий
Начинающий
Аватара пользователя
Зарегистрирован: 18 фев 2013, 12:29
Наличности на руках:
153.09

Сообщения: 264
В данных мк загрузчик запрограммирован с завода и его невозможно стереть. У мк есть два пина BOOT0 и BOOT1, которые управляют откуда стартует мк, чтобы стартовал загрузчик через UART ноги должны быть в такой конфигурации boot0=1 boot1=0 (для старта с внутренней флешки пин БУТ0=0, а БУТ1 игнорируется, так что на плате может быть всего лишь один джампер который переключает БУТ0). Какие это пины зависит от корпуса, например в корпусе LQFP64 BOOT0 - 60 нога, а BOOT1 - 28 нога.


Не в сети
 Профиль    
 
[ТС]
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 11 мар 2021, 13:07 
Я тут случайно
Я тут случайно
Аватара пользователя
Зарегистрирован: 18 янв 2016, 11:46
Наличности на руках:
4.01

Сообщения: 2
Откуда: Antonik
Не знаю о каком не стираемом загрузчике идет речь но мой мк начисто очищен. Программа так и предупредила что после снятия зашиты прошивка все данные будут стерты.
Вот пдф см 12 страница: https://www.st.com/resource/en/user_man ... ronics.pdf
По поводу режима загрузки и чтения у меня схема есть под рукой.


Не в сети
 Профиль    
 
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 11 мар 2021, 19:41 
Начинающий
Начинающий
Аватара пользователя
Зарегистрирован: 18 фев 2013, 12:29
Наличности на руках:
153.09

Сообщения: 264
Загрузчик располагается в system memory (System memory is used to boot the device in System memory boot mode. The area is reserved for use by STMicroelectronics and contains the boot loader which is used to reprogram the Flash memory using the USART1 serial interface. It is programmed by ST when the device is manufactured, and protected against spurious write/erase
operations), а то что вы стёрли - это user flash. Пинами БУТ0 и БУТ1 настраивается откуда стартует мк: системная память, флеш с прошивкой или оперативка.
Если у вас мк был залочен от чтения пользовательской флеши, то скорее всего имеющиеся в интернете прошивки неполные (для прошивки IAP - in-app-programming, средствами самой прошивки, но в таком случае начало user flash защищено от записи). В этом случае полная прошивка имеется только у производителя - в этом и есть смысл защиты от чтения.


Не в сети
 Профиль    
 
[ТС]
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 13 мар 2021, 11:45 
Я тут случайно
Я тут случайно
Аватара пользователя
Зарегистрирован: 18 янв 2016, 11:46
Наличности на руках:
4.01

Сообщения: 2
Откуда: Antonik
Я мало в этом разбираюсь. в своем случаи я выставлял boot1 - 0 к земле он же 28мая нога он же PB2. Boot0 - 1 60тая нога провел к 3.3 через резистор 1кОм. TX,RX - 43,42нога. И в таком режима стер все кнопкой "Remove protection". Каждый раз после залития прошивок возвращал boot0 на земля для проверки. После включения белый экран а комп видит как не известное устройство.


Не в сети
 Профиль    
 
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 14 мар 2021, 07:33 
Начинающий
Начинающий
Аватара пользователя
Зарегистрирован: 18 фев 2013, 12:29
Наличности на руках:
153.09

Сообщения: 264
Т.е. производитель программатора не предусматривает прошивку своего устройства через UART. Следовательно вам остаётся только писать в поддержку производителю, чтобы вам выслали хотя бы прошитый мк.


Не в сети
 Профиль    
 
 Заголовок сообщения: Re: Quainly Icopy Plus прошивка микроконтроллера STM32F103RET6
СообщениеДобавлено: 31 окт 2022, 22:55 
Интересующийся
Интересующийся
Аватара пользователя
Зарегистрирован: 16 ноя 2014, 17:17
Наличности на руках:
6.03

Сообщения: 26
Откуда: Ukraine
aik_has
Доброго времени суток! Чем закончился ремонт? Прошивку/дамп удалось найти?


Не в сети
 Профиль    
 
Показать сообщения за:  Поле сортировки  
 Страница 1 из 1 [ Сообщений: 7 ] 


   Похожие темы   Автор   Ответы   Просмотры   Последнее сообщение 
В этой теме нет новых непрочитанных сообщений. Прошивка микроконтроллера БП Gophert CPS-6011

в форуме Ремонт блоков питания | Power supply repair

Vkvark

0

826

23 окт 2022, 20:48

Vkvark Перейти к последнему сообщению

В этой теме нет новых непрочитанных сообщений. Lenovo ideaCentre K410 (CIH61MI) Ищу дамп для микроконтроллера STM8S103F2P6 платы переключения режимов питания

в форуме Lenovo IBM

Vladka76

4

2827

09 апр 2018, 00:04

Vladka76 Перейти к последнему сообщению

Эта тема закрыта, вы не можете редактировать и оставлять сообщения в ней. Замена микроконтроллера Daslight4

в форуме Аудиотехника

Flagmans

0

1844

28 фев 2020, 13:55

Flagmans Перейти к последнему сообщению

В этой теме нет новых непрочитанных сообщений. Peлe напpяжeния НoвaTeк РH-106 - замена микроконтроллера, возможно ли?

в форуме Ремонт бытовой техники | Repair of household appliances

Джони

1

1533

16 авг 2021, 09:05

kgbeast Перейти к последнему сообщению

В этой теме нет новых непрочитанных сообщений. iPhone 7/7 Plus /8/8 Plus замена экрана ,не совместимость.

в форуме iPhone

protao

9

10907

11 дек 2018, 15:33

protao Перейти к последнему сообщению


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 5


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ти: